    Jiangsu text public examination will answer for you:The interview format of Jiangsu public institutions is:Structured interviewsThe main assessment elements include: comprehensive analysis ability; verbal skills; resilience; planning, organization, coordination skills; interpersonal awareness and skills; self-emotional control; Job search motivation and job matching; Manners.

    In recent years, there have been two special assessment elements in the national examination interview: service awareness and skills, and initiative.

    In the past three years, Jiangsu's ability to test the interview questions of public institutions mainly involvesComprehensive analysis ability, planning, organization and coordination ability, interpersonal communication ability, adaptability, service awareness and skills, initiativeWait.

    The requirements for ability are becoming more and more detailed, the form is more flexible while the questions are stable, and some details of innovation also need to be paid attention to. In recent years, there have been more and more questions in the form of follow-up questions and scenario simulation questions, which can be rooted in the ability requirements, but the ability presentation forms are diverse, which will also catch the candidates off guard.

    Prepare in advance and pay attention to the image. Image determines fate, and any industry has certain requirements for practitioners, such as more demanding bank practitioners. Although public officials do not have such strict requirements as Qin Draft, being too casual will also cause the examiner to resent and lower their scores.

    Candidates must have a more suitable set of clothing before participating in the interview, boys can prepare a suit, and girls can refer to buying professional clothing. Then there is to pay attention to your behavior habits in daily life, such as walking, sitting, etc., which will affect your overall image.

    Prepare expertise ahead of time. Nowadays, the types of examination questions in public institutions are becoming more and more flexible, and the methods are becoming more and more flexible, and many places have begun to conduct professional tests according to the position setting, which also requires candidates to pay attention to. After graduating from college or working for a long time, it is inevitable that you will be a little unfamiliar with professional knowledge, so candidates must prepare in advance.

    The professional knowledge involved in the interview of public institutions is generally not too in-depth, as long as the candidates are proficient in the basic knowledge of the subject, they can deal with it well, so reading some introductory textbooks or reading their original textbooks are good review methods.

    Change bad habits and make a good impression. Everyone has some bad habits in their daily life, such as shaking their legs and blinking. Turning the pen, etc., and these habits will leave a bad impression on the examiner, candidates can record ** by themselves in the process of answering the questions, and correct it in time.

    Train ahead of time to eliminate tension. When people enter a completely unfamiliar environment, they will definitely become very nervous, and if they have not experienced similar scenes, they will not have confidence in their hearts, and the tension will intensify. Therefore, in the interview examination room, you need to do a lot of training in advance to play normally, candidates can understand the specific interview situation of the application unit in advance, and understand the exam questions in advance, on the one hand, pay attention to the answer questions in the daily training, on the other hand, to simulate the examination room, it is best to find colleagues or classmates as examiners, to face more people to simulate, which will achieve relatively good results.

    If you find that you are nervous in the examination room, you can take a deep breath in advance to control it, and at the same time, you can quickly read the questions and think after entering the room, and when you are highly concentrated, you can respect and relieve the tension appropriately.

    1. Interview registration and lottery drawing. You need to report to the designated interview location 10-30 minutes before the test, and the staff will check the candidates' relevant documents.

    2. Waiting for the exam. Candidates will know their exam questions after drawing lots, and at this time they will have to wait for the exam in the waiting area, and when they wait for you, the staff will naturally call you.

    3. Enter the examination room. The staff will call the candidates to enter the test room in order, and enter the test room by themselves when you are called to the test number.

    4. Answer the questions and the interview begins. After the candidate enters the examination room, he can sit down after getting the instruction of "please sit", the examination time is about 20-30 minutes, there will be 4-5 questions, during the interview, the candidate can not report his name, otherwise he will be disqualified from the interview.

    5. Exit. After the candidate has finished answering the questions, the examiner will announce the candidate's exit, and the candidate can go to the waiting room to wait for the score.

    6. Publish the results. After the examiner has checked the scores, they will be handed over to the supervisor for review, and the supervisor and the examiner will announce the results to the candidates after they have signed.
